Pederson, David R.; Moran, Greg – Monographs of the Society for Research in Child Development, 1995
Presents the Maternal Behavior Q-Set, a 90-item assessment that describes a wide range of maternal behavior including interactive style, her sensitivity to her infant's state, feeding interactions, and the extent to which the home reflects the infant's needs. (HTH)
